EDITOR NOTE – There is some confusion online about the Magic Bullet not having BPA free cups. According to the company, all models made after 2010 are BPA Free. The Magic Bullet instruction manuals all now say their containers are BPA free. BPA is typically more of a concern if you are heating the plastic. The company says you can heat their containers in the microwave but I would NOT recommend it with any plastic, not only because various foods can leech into the plastic but I would be concerned about the safety of the microwave impacting the strength of the plastic.
